Hi Steve,

The 181 feels and sounds very good below the staff. I've played a number of rotary F's and feel the the 181 is as good or better than most. I haven't played an F tuba with a better "C" than the Yamahas. I personally don't have a problem learning to adjust to the different feel of a rotary F, yes, it takes a while to get used to but I think is is well worth the effort(for me)sound wise. It really depends on the sound you are looking for. There are compromises to think of when deciding on an F tuba. Maybe someday there will be the perfect F tuba for all according to their tasts, rotary and piston in a variety of sizes. Maybe that tuba exists now?
